mod_rewrite, resp. reguláry

Tak už jsem na ty reguláry dojel...
mám .htaccess (k velkému překvapení :-) ):

RewriteEngine On

RewriteRule ^soubory_ke_stazeni/.*$ /files.php

R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*) /index.php

pochopitelně, na hostingu (nn, WZ ne) se mi ty dvě pravidla třískaj - adresa www.domain.tld/soubory_ke_stazeni/foo.foo se přepíše na www.domain.tld/files.php

To je ok, ale to druhý pravidlo mi www.domian.tld/files.php přepíše na www.domain.tld/index.php

Takže jsem se snažil vyvinout podmníku, která by tomu zabránila... už dost dlouho trápím server regexp.cz a došel jsem k tomu, že ta podmínka dělá přesný opak toho, než chci....

RewriteCond %{REQUEST_URI} [^files\.php]$ [NC] //umístěna před druhé pravidlo

zkrátka a jednoduše, tipnul bych si, že můj problém tkví v tom, že neumím napsat "vše kromě výrazu files.php" - v té podmínce se to bere po znacích...

hledám už dva dny jak vzteklej a nic, takže vás pokorně prosím o pomoc...
Takže jelikož v Liberci zřejmě není člověka, co by uměl negovat výrok, našel jsem si v mod_rewrite taháku odkazovaném na JPW, že stačí za pravidlo napsat [S=1], což znamená, že při splnění pravidla se další pravidlo vynechá.... Jak prosté :-)